WebDec 14, 2024 · Incomplete dominance Mendel’s results were groundbreaking partly because they contradicted the (then-popular) idea that parents' traits were permanently blended in their offspring. In some cases, however, the phenotype of a heterozygous organism can actually be a blend between the phenotypes of its homozygous parents. WebWith incomplete dominance, a cross between organisms with two different phenotypes produces offspring with a thirdphenotype that is a blendingof the parental traits. It's like mixing paints, red + white will make pink. Red doesn't totally block (dominate) the pink, instead there is incompletedominance, and we end up with something in-between. WebIncomplete Dominance: Definition, Examples, and Practice Problems You may already know that in the study of genetics, dominance refers to the relationship between alleles, which are two forms of a gene. In a dominant relationship between alleles, one allele “masks” the other and influences a specific trait.
